A working sump pump is critical for keeping your basement dry. But, like all devices, sump pumps eventually become outdated. Knowing when to replace yours and understanding the costs involved can prevent headaches.
Signs that it's time for a new pump include constant cycling, weak performance, unusual noises, and flooding. The cost of replacing a sump pump can change significantly, depending on the size of the pump, its features (like battery backup), and the complexity of the installation.
- On average, a basic sump pump replacement can cost anywhere from $500 to $1,500.
- Feature-rich systems with redundancy can range between $1,500 and $3,000 or more.

Discovering a Reliable Sump Pump Installer Near You
Protecting your foundation from water damage is crucial, and a reliable sump pump is essential for that protection. But, finding a qualified technician can be challenging. Here are some suggestions to help you find the right person for your needs.
Commence by asking neighbors for recommendations. Word-of-mouth can be a valuable guide for finding trustworthy service providers. You can also check online reviews that specialize in home repairs.
When you've narrowed down a few potential installers, call them for estimates. Be sure to ask their experience with sump pump installations and demand references from satisfied homeowners.
A reputable installer will be eager to provide this information and answer any questions you may have.
